Competed professionally in tennis, gaining recognition on the Women's Tennis Association circuit. Achieved a career-high singles ranking of 64 in the world. Participated in Grand Slam tournaments, including the Australian Open and French Open. In 2016, won the Wimbledon girl's singles championship, marking an important milestone in professional career.

Sharadindu Bandyopadhyay

Indian author and playwright, Bengali literature
Born
March 30th, 1899 125 years ago
Died
1970 55 years ago — 71 years old

An influential figure in Bengali literature, this individual contributed significantly to the genres of detective fiction and fantasy. As a prolific author, produced numerous works that captivated readers, including the beloved creation Byomkesh Bakshi, a fictional detective who solved intricate mysteries. Crafted several plays that explored various themes, enriching the theatrical landscape of Bengal. The writer's adaptability in various literary formats showcased talent across novels, short stories, and screenplays, reflecting the cultural milieu of the time.
